export type Replacer = (
content: string,
find: string,
) => Generator<string, void, unknown>
export const SimpleReplacer: Replacer = function* (_content, find) {
yield find
}
export const LineTrimmedReplacer: Replacer = function* (content, find) {
const originalLines = content.split("\n")
const searchLines = find.split("\n")
if (searchLines[searchLines.length - 1] === "") {
searchLines.pop()
}
for (let i = 0; i <= originalLines.length - searchLines.length; i++) {
let matches = true
for (let j = 0; j < searchLines.length; j++) {
const originalTrimmed = originalLines[i + j].trim()
const searchTrimmed = searchLines[j].trim()
if (originalTrimmed !== searchTrimmed) {
matches = false
break
}
}
if (matches) {
let matchStartIndex = 0
for (let k = 0; k < i; k++) {
matchStartIndex += originalLines[k].length + 1
}
let matchEndIndex = matchStartIndex
for (let k = 0; k < searchLines.length; k++) {
matchEndIndex += originalLines[i + k].length + 1
}
yield content.substring(matchStartIndex, matchEndIndex)
}
}
}
export const BlockAnchorReplacer: Replacer = function* (content, find) {
const originalLines = content.split("\n")
const searchLines = find.split("\n")
if (searchLines.length < 3) {
return
}
if (searchLines[searchLines.length - 1] === "") {
searchLines.pop()
}
const firstLineSearch = searchLines[0].trim()
const lastLineSearch = searchLines[searchLines.length - 1].trim()
// Find blocks where first line matches the search first line
for (let i = 0; i < originalLines.length; i++) {
if (originalLines[i].trim() !== firstLineSearch) {
continue
}
// Look for the matching last line after this first line
for (let j = i + 2; j < originalLines.length; j++) {
if (originalLines[j].trim() === lastLineSearch) {
// Found a potential block from i to j
let matchStartIndex = 0
for (let k = 0; k < i; k++) {
matchStartIndex += originalLines[k].length + 1
}
let matchEndIndex = matchStartIndex
for (let k = 0; k <= j - i; k++) {
matchEndIndex += originalLines[i + k].length + 1
}
yield content.substring(matchStartIndex, matchEndIndex)
break // Only match the first occurrence of the last line
}
}
}
}
export const WhitespaceNormalizedReplacer: Replacer = function* (
content,
find,
) {
const normalizeWhitespace = (text: string) => text.replace(/\s+/g, " ").trim()
const normalizedFind = normalizeWhitespace(find)
// Handle single line matches
const lines = content.split("\n")
for (let i = 0; i < lines.length; i++) {
const line = lines[i]
if (normalizeWhitespace(line) === normalizedFind) {
yield line
}
// Also check for substring matches within lines
const normalizedLine = normalizeWhitespace(line)
if (normalizedLine.includes(normalizedFind)) {
// Find the actual substring in the original line that matches
const words = find.trim().split(/\s+/)
if (words.length > 0) {
const pattern = words
.map((word) => word.replace(/[.*+?^${}()|[\]\\]/g, "\\$&"))
.join("\\s+")
const regex = new RegExp(pattern)
const match = line.match(regex)
if (match) {
yield match[0]
}
}
}
}
// Handle multi-line matches
const findLines = find.split("\n")
if (findLines.length > 1) {
for (let i = 0; i <= lines.length - findLines.length; i++) {
const block = lines.slice(i, i + findLines.length)
if (normalizeWhitespace(block.join("\n")) === normalizedFind) {
yield block.join("\n")
}
}
}
}
export const IndentationFlexibleReplacer: Replacer = function* (content, find) {
const removeIndentation = (text: string) => {
const lines = text.split("\n")
const nonEmptyLines = lines.filter((line) => line.trim().length > 0)
if (nonEmptyLines.length === 0) return text
const minIndent = Math.min(
...nonEmptyLines.map((line) => {
const match = line.match(/^(\s*)/)
return match ? match[1].length : 0
}),
)
return lines
.map((line) => (line.trim().length === 0 ? line : line.slice(minIndent)))
.join("\n")
}
const normalizedFind = removeIndentation(find)
const contentLines = content.split("\n")
const findLines = find.split("\n")
for (let i = 0; i <= contentLines.length - findLines.length; i++) {
const block = contentLines.slice(i, i + findLines.length).join("\n")
if (removeIndentation(block) === normalizedFind) {
yield block
}
}
}

export function replace(
content: string,
oldString: string,
newString: string,
replaceAll = false,
): string {
for (const replacer of [
SimpleReplacer,
LineTrimmedReplacer,
BlockAnchorReplacer,
WhitespaceNormalizedReplacer,
IndentationFlexibleReplacer,
]) {
for (const search of replacer(content, oldString)) {
const index = content.indexOf(search)
if (index === -1) continue
if (replaceAll) {
return content.replaceAll(search, newString)
}
const lastIndex = content.lastIndexOf(search)
if (index !== lastIndex) continue
return (
content.substring(0, index) +
newString +
content.substring(index + search.length)
)
}
}
throw new Error("oldString not found in content or was found multiple times")
}
